We all have heard about the Hidden Mickey's that Imagineers put in attractions and rides at Disneyland. How many have you actually seen with your own eyes and where did you see it/them.

1. Mr Toad's Wild Ride on the back of the second set of doors at the entrance.

2. Pirates of the Carribean - not there since the rehab, but the Pirate Ship Captains hat formed the shadow of Mickey's head on the sail in back of him when his head turned a certain way. He did it every time a boat came out of the cavern in the battle scene. They changed the hat and the lighting in the most recent rehab.

While I was working in Fantasyland (Summer 1998 for those who haven't read the College With the Mouse series) I noticed a really cool one in Pinocchio's Daring Journey. It was a wooden Mickey head on a wooden post in the "Pool Hall." One night, while doing my walkthough, I noticed it had been ripped off. I asked my manager if I should call Facilities or someone and have them replace it. He said no, but they would look into it. It is still missing.
If you look on the first post on the right when you come into the room, you'll see that the coloring is a little different in one spot -- that's where the head used to be.

I was once working the popcorn cart in the Sunshine Plaza at DCA and i noticed a bunch of custodial staring at the ground looking for something (did I mention it was a really slow day??). So i asked what they were looking for and they told me they heard there a Mickey Stone embedded in the ground amoung the other rocks. So at my first chance i looked, and sure enough there is a perfect Mickey stone right underneath the little bench attached to the wall behind the popcorn cart, its kinda cute.
